<p>The UK Aid Strategy set out how the government’s aid budget will be restructured
to ensure that it is spent on tackling the great global challenges from the root cause
of migration and disease to the threat of terrorism and climate change, all of which
impact the world’s poor and directly threaten Britain’s interests. The UK Aid Strategy
sets out spending and reporting requirements.</p><p>All departments spending ODA will
be required to put in place a clear plan to ensure that their programme design, quality
assurance, approval, contracting and procurement, monitoring, reporting and evaluation
processes represent international best practice. All UK ODA is administered with the
promotion of the economic development and welfare of developing countries as its main
objective, in line with the internationally agreed rules on ODA.</p><p>ODA-spending
departments and funds must provide accurate and timely information on their ODA spending
to DFID to meet OECD reporting requirements.</p>
